MOVIE REVIEW: IN THE FACE OF EVIL

Doug from Upland, FreeRepublic.com
Oct. 4, 2004

The Liberty Film Festival was a remarkable event held in West Hollywood, the backyard of the liberal elite. Experienced and new producers provided entertainment for an activist and very eager conservative audience. It is the audience that Hollywood has not only disregarded, but also insulted.

One of the standout movies of the weekend was IN THE FACE OF EVIL. For those on the left who have denigrated and mocked Ronald Reagan, this epic documentary is the answer that sets the record straight. Steve Bannon’s work is destined to be remembered as the definitive work on the man whose 45-year mission was to destroy the greatest evil of the 20th Century.

Reagan was not a Phi Beta Kappa. He was not among the Northeast liberal elite. He was not at the top of his class at Harvard Law. No, Reagan came from Middle America stock with Middle America values. He was a man with values, determination, and vision. And, along with Winston Churchill, he was one of the two great men of his century.

From sport caster to actor to governor to president, it was an unlikely journey. It was a unique journey, yet a journey so typical of what has made America great.

Bannon teaches a history lesson that is not taught in our elementary schools, our high schools, or our universities. It is one that those on the left want to ignore. They ignore it because they cannot admit that they were wrong and Reagan was right. They ignore it because their worldview would come crashing down. They ignore it because they just cannot stand the use of the word “evil.” Communism was evil. It was the greatest evil. Reagan recognized it and called it such. That drove those on the left into an hysterial frenzy.

IN THE FACE OF EVIL chronicles the birth of communism, its rule over people’s lives for three quarters of a century, and its demise. History will recognize a thousand years in the future that one man had the courage and will to face this evil, to lead the fight against this evil, and to defeat this evil. It was an evil that took away man's hopes, man's dreams, and tens of millions of their lives.

The Soviets thought Reagan was a simpleton. His opponents in this country thought he was a simpleton. This genuine good and decent man connected with the people. His vision of freedom was the vision that the natural right of man was to live free. He dedicated his life to that fight.

In every way, overt and covert, Reagan challenged the Soviets. He challenged them militarily around the world. He attacked their currency and took actions to prevent their acquisition of hard assets they needed to keep afloat their tremendous military machine. And he finally broke their backs with his brilliant program called the Strategic Defense Initiative (SDI), dubbed by his detractors as “Star Wars.”

The audience at the Liberty Film Fetival was riveted. They cheered, and at times they had tears in their eyes. They swelled with good old-fashioned American patriotism as they watched and heard six famous words that changed the world: Mr. Gorbachev, tear down this wall.

Bannon did a magnificent job of getting the insiders to tell their stories, the stories we have never heard before. This simpleton, this actor, was really more brilliant than anyone ever imagined.

Let the detractors ignore history, and let them continue to make fun of this great man. It doesn’t matter. Hundreds of millions of people around the world who are now living in freedom love this man and his America that led the fight for their freedom and for the freedom of their children. They are forever grateful.

Steve Bannon, we are forever grateful.

The Right Stuff
In Hollywood, a Film Festival That's Rated GOP

By William Booth
Washington Post Staff Writer
Monday, October 4, 2004; Page C01


-- snip --

Billed as the first conservative film festival in Hollywood, the three-day affair showcased comic shorts, one about the "ultimate minority" in Tinseltown ("Greg Wolfe: Republican Jew"), an epic homage to Ronald Reagan and his battle against Soviet communism ("In the Face of Evil") and a snappy doc on tart-tongued commentator Ann Coulter ("Is It True What They Say About Ann?"), in which Coulter signs the T-shirt of a leftie college student with the words "Have fun in Guantanamo!"

-- snip --

Ron Smith, an activist with the conservative Web site Freerepublic.com, sat for the whole festival in the front row. "I'll give this to Michael Moore," he says. "He created a chain reaction. We have to thank him for that." He agreed that the anti-Moore, pro-Bush films were slow out of the gates, "but I'll tell you, this is just the beginning. We've got the Internet and talk radio and now we've got films. This is just a dry run. It'll be better next time around."

IN THE FACE OF EVIL

Reagan’s War in Word & Deed is a man and nation’s journey through the heart of darkness—and what that journey means for us today. This film is not a biography of Ronald Reagan, but a hard-hitting look at leadership and moral courage. Based on Peter Schweizer’s acclaimed bestseller, Reagan’s War, the new feature-length documentary film, In the Face of Evil chronicles the brutal conflict between totalitarianism and freedom as seen through Ronald Reagan’s forty-year confrontation with Communism.
